Signs A Pipe May Need Relining

If you’re not sure whether your pipes require relining, here are some indicators to look out for:

  • Water leakage
  • Odors coming from your drains
  • The sound of gurgling is coming from your drains
  • Clogs or slow drainage

Types of Pipes That Are Able To Be Relined

We are able to provide sliplining Pakenham to many different types of pipes which include:

  • Pressure pipes
  • Storm water pipes
  • Sewer pipes
  • Cast iron pipes
  • Pool pipes
  • Down pipes
  • PVC pipes
  • Earthenware

The Pipe Relining Process

In the past when you needed to fix a pipe, you needed to dig. It was dirty, time-consuming and expensive process.

With pipe relining, also known as trenchless pipe lining , or trenchless sewer repair, it’s possible to bypass all that. Simply said, pipe relining Pakenham is the process of encasement new pipes into older ones.

Dodging up the yard, banging, and causing structural damage to your house are gone. If your pipe is leaking, you can line it by relining it. The pipe could be relined if it is structurally sound.

We offer the following simple, messfree process:

  • We Investigate
  • We Clear
  • We Reline
  • We Cure & Cut
  • We Clean

Can You Reline Pipes With Bends In Them?

The trenchless pipe relining process is a wonderful, non-dig method of fixing broken pipes that have bends in their walls. The process of pipe relining makes an entirely new pipe inside an existing pipeline. This means that you don’t have to remove the previous pipe and will be able to fix it without having to dig up your yard or driveway.

The difficulties of a pipe-relining job gets more difficult with more bends within the pipe. Our team of experts have lined many sewer lines with bends in them.

While this is challenging, it’s not impossible and we’ve got the experience and the knowledge to get this project done right.

Can Sliplining Stop Tree Roots From Entering Sewer?

Yes, trenchless pipe relining services could help in stopping tree roots from getting into your sewer. Sliplining is the process of creating a new pipe inside of the old one. This helps seal off any cracks or openings that might allow tree roots to access.

Also, regular maintenance and cleaning of your sewer system can help prevent tree roots from entering.

Can A Collapsed Pipe Be Relined?

We are not able to reline a collapsed pipe. If you have a collapsed pipe then you’ll require replacing the pipe in its entirety. If you are not sure the extent of damage to your pipe you are able to have us come out to conduct an inspection for you.

Does Pipe Relining Reduce The Pipe Flow?

There is usually no decrease in pipe flow due to pipe relining. In fact, pipe relining can often increase how much water flows that flows through the pipe because it creates a smooth, new surface for water to travel through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Used?

Pipe relining was used for many years, and the first time it was documented being in 1854. It was only in the early 2000’s when it started to become more popular.

Pipe relining technology is utilised all over the world as an effective solution to fix leaky or damaged pipes without the need to tear them out and replace them completely. There are a variety of pipe relining solutions that can be used according to the type of pipe used and the severity of what the issue is.

For example, there is spot pipe relining Pakenham, which is used for small leaks or structural pipe replacement which is used to repair more serious damage. Whatever type of pipe relining used in the job process, the purpose remains the same: fixing the pipe without replacing it entirely.
